Abstract

BackgroundThe Coronavirus disease 2019 (COVID-19) outbreak has left a lasting mark on medicine globally.MethodsHere we outline the steps that the Lenox Hill Hospital/Northwell Health Neurosurgery Department—located within the epicenter of the pandemic in New York City—is currently taking to recover our neurosurgical efforts in the age of COVID-19.ResultsWe outline measurable milestones to identify the transition to the recovery period and hope these recommendations may serve as a framework for an effective path forward.ConclusionsWe believe that recovery following the COVID-19 pandemic offers unique opportunities to disrupt and rebuild the historical patient and office experience as we evolve with modern medicine in a post–COVID-19 world.
